Exemplo n.º 1
0
        public IActionResult Order([FromForm] Models.Trbovlje.OrderCatalogArticleViewModel orderCatalogArticle)
        {
            if (!ModelState.IsValid)
            {
                return(View(orderCatalogArticle));
            }

            OrderCatalogArticle dbOrderCatalogArticle = new OrderCatalogArticle();

            _mapper.Map(orderCatalogArticle, dbOrderCatalogArticle);
            _dbContext.OrderCatalogArticles.Add(dbOrderCatalogArticle);
            _dbContext.SaveChanges();

            return(RedirectToAction("Index"));
        }
Exemplo n.º 2
0
        private void InitOrderCatalogArticle()
        {
            if (_appDbContext.OrderCatalogArticles.Any())
            {
                return;
            }

            var orderCatalogArticle = new OrderCatalogArticle
            {
                CatalogArticle = _appDbContext.CatalogArticles.FirstOrDefault(),
                Quantity       = 4,
                UrgencyDegree  = UrgencyDegree.Three,
                Note           = "Order note",
                ReceptionTime  = DateTime.Today.AddDays(-1),
                ReceptionUser  = _appDbContext.Users.FirstOrDefault(),
            };

            _appDbContext.Add(orderCatalogArticle);
            _appDbContext.SaveChanges();
        }